More plant-based food options? Yes! DuPont Nutrition & Health, a company that works with food manufacturers and producers all over the world to, “make food safer, healthier, better-tasting and easier to produce,” has launched three new plant-based nuggets.

The nuggets are an impressive 90 percent protein. They are soy-based and have a neutral flavor and a crispy, crunchy texture. The three nuggets are an extension of DuPonts first Nugget, Supro Nuggets 570, a nugget with a light, crispy textured nugget with a barrel shape. Now, three new nuggets have been added to the line-up: Supro Nuggets 580, Supro Nuggets 583, and Supro Nuggets 585. DuPont notes that the nuggets can be used in a wide variety of food products, such as nutrition bars, clustered cereal, and yogurt toppings.

“Consumers want products with simple ingredient statements and high protein,” says Jean Heggie, strategic marketing lead, Protein Solutions Business Unit, DuPont Nutrition & Health.

Demand for protein in the developed and developing world is at an all-time high, with the average person in the U.S. consuming 103 grams per day, around double the actual recommended amount, two-thirds of which comes from animal-based sources. This is a serious issue not only from a health standpoint (too much protein isn’t great for you either) but it’s wreaking havoc on the environment and pushing our already strained natural resources to the brink.

Globally, industrialized animal agriculture already covers over 45 percent of the world’s land mass, uses a majority of finite freshwater water resources, and is responsible for rampant air and water pollution – not to mention is the largest singular source of global greenhouse gas emissions. Even with all the resources that this industry uses, nearly one billion people still go hungry.
